Overview
Lomitapide Mesylate is an inhibitor of microsomal triglyceride transfer protein and is used as an adjunct to a low-fat diet and other lipid-lowering treatments for the prevention and chronic management of hyperlipidemia. It reduces levels of cholesterol by limiting the secretion of triglyceride-rich lipoproteins into the bloodstream.
